diff --git a/gio/gdbusutils.c b/gio/gdbusutils.c index eb7eee9c8..bb34e2d58 100644 --- a/gio/gdbusutils.c +++ b/gio/gdbusutils.c @@ -693,3 +693,127 @@ g_dbus_gvalue_to_gvariant (const GValue *gvalue, return ret; } + +/** + * g_dbus_escape_object_path_bytestring: + * @bytes: (array zero-terminated=1) (element-type guint8): the string of bytes to escape + * + * Escapes @bytes for use in a D-Bus object path component. + * @bytes is an array of zero or more nonzero bytes in an + * unspecified encoding, followed by a single zero byte. + * + * The escaping method consists of replacing all non-alphanumeric + * characters (see g_ascii_isalnum()) with their hexadecimal value + * preceded by an underscore (`_`). For example: + * `foo.bar.baz` will become `foo_2ebar_2ebaz`. + * + * This method is appropriate to use when the input is nearly + * a valid object path component but is not when your input + * is far from being a valid object path component. + * Other escaping algorithms are also valid to use with + * D-Bus object paths. + * + * This can be reversed with g_dbus_unescape_object_path(). + * + * Returns: an escaped version of @bytes. Free with g_free(). + * + * Since: 2.68 + * + */ +gchar * +g_dbus_escape_object_path_bytestring (const guint8 *bytes) +{ + GString *escaped; + const guint8 *p; + + g_return_val_if_fail (bytes != NULL, NULL); + + if (*bytes == '\0') + return g_strdup ("_"); + + escaped = g_string_new (NULL); + for (p = bytes; *p; p++) + { + if (g_ascii_isalnum (*p)) + g_string_append_c (escaped, *p); + else + g_string_append_printf (escaped, "_%02x", *p); + } + + return g_string_free (escaped, FALSE); +} + +/** + * g_dbus_escape_object_path: + * @s: the string to escape + * + * This is a language binding friendly version of g_dbus_escape_object_path_bytestring(). + * + * Returns: an escaped version of @s. Free with g_free(). + * + * Since: 2.68 + */ +gchar * +g_dbus_escape_object_path (const gchar *s) +{ + return (gchar *) g_dbus_escape_object_path_bytestring ((const guint8 *) s); +} + +/** + * g_dbus_unescape_object_path: + * @s: the string to unescape + * + * Unescapes an string that was previously escaped with + * g_dbus_escape_object_path(). If the string is in a format that could + * not have been returned by g_dbus_escape_object_path(), this function + * returns %NULL. + * + * Encoding alphanumeric characters which do not need to be + * encoded is not allowed (e.g `_63` is not valid, the string + * should contain `c` instead). + * + * Returns: (array zero-terminated=1) (element-type guint8) (nullable): an + * unescaped version of @s, or %NULL if @s is not a string returned + * from g_dbus_escape_object_path(). Free with g_free(). + * + * Since: 2.68 + */ +guint8 * +g_dbus_unescape_object_path (const gchar *s) +{ + GString *unescaped; + const gchar *p; + + g_return_val_if_fail (s != NULL, NULL); + + if (g_str_equal (s, "_")) + return (guint8 *) g_strdup (""); + + unescaped = g_string_new (NULL); + for (p = s; *p; p++) + { + gint hi, lo; + + if (g_ascii_isalnum (*p)) + { + g_string_append_c (unescaped, *p); + } + else if (*p == '_' && + ((hi = g_ascii_xdigit_value (p[1])) >= 0) && + ((lo = g_ascii_xdigit_value (p[2])) >= 0) && + (hi || lo) && /* \0 is not allowed */ + !g_ascii_isalnum ((hi << 4) | lo)) /* alnums must not be encoded */ + { + g_string_append_c (unescaped, (hi << 4) | lo); + p += 2; + } + else + { + /* the string was not encoded correctly */ + g_string_free (unescaped, TRUE); + return NULL; + } + } + + return (guint8 *) g_string_free (unescaped, FALSE); +} |
